Strings on the deformed T^{1,1}: giant magnon and single spike solutions
arXiv:0908.3065 · doi:10.1088/1126-6708/2009/10/019
Abstract
In this paper we find giant magnon and single spike string solutions in a sector of the gamma-deformed conifold. We examine the dispersion relations and find a behavior analogous to the undeformed case. The transcendental functional relations between the conserved charges are shifted by certain gamma-dependent term. The latter is proportional to the total momentum and thus qualitatively different from known cases.
